On opening, re-roll your rug pile out and leave it in a warm room for 24 hours before putting it in place, this will help to reduce wrinkles and curling from packing. Please note that a small amount of fibre loss is normal on a new rug. Use an anti-slip mat to help keep your rug in place and to provide additional protection for hard floors. Before using any cleaning products on your rug – test on an inconspicuous area first to check colour fastness and do not pull any loose threads, cut loose threads carefully with scissors. Avoid prolonged exposure to direct sunlight as this may cause fading of some dyes. Ensure to turn your rug regularly to ensure even wear. Clean spills immediately by blotting with a clean dry white cloth - do not rub. This rug may be carefully vacuumed using a floor or brush attachment, vacuuming the back of your rug with the rotating brush tool will help to push any dirt which is trapped deep down towards the top of the rug, it can then be flipped right side up and this dirt can be shaken off. A Legacy of Home Comfort Dunelm's Journey

Dunelm isn't just another store; it's a British legacy. Kicked off in 1979 by the dynamic duo, Bill and Jeany Adderley, what began as a simple market stall in Leicester transformed into one of the UK's most prominent home furnishings retailers.

Fast forward a bit, and their first brick-and-mortar store sprang to life in Leicester in 1984. Dunelm didn't stop there, making waves throughout the decades, innovating and expanding, launching an online shopping experience, and securing its place on the London Stock Exchange.
